I am not against webinars, but the knowledge you get in reading a complete book is far better than attending a webinar.

As many of you were asking me the books to read, I am listing some of the books that cover option strategies, Greeks, Trading psychology, Risk management.

2/7

I suggest you to read 1 to 5 books first and then choose other books as per your interest.

I am giving amazon links for reference so that you can read the preview and decide, it doesn't mean that you need to purchase. You can always search the web for free pdf :)
